[solved] Modem Huawei: Problem after fedup from 19 to 20

2014-07-24 Thread Dario Lesca
After fedup from 19 to 20, my USB modem Huawei (ID 12d1:1436 Huawei Technologies Co., Ltd. E173 3G Modem) not work anymore. After various analyzes I have discover that the service ModemManager.service has been disabled. systemctl enable and start it and the problem is left. Thanks -- Dario
